What is an Athena?

In the professional world, 'Athena' most commonly refers to Amazon Athena, which is an interactive query service provided by Amazon Web Services (AWS) that allows users to analyze data directly in Amazon S3 using standard SQL. People with the job title 'Athena Specialist' or 'Athena Developer' typically work with data analytics, writing SQL queries, and managing cloud data infrastructure. Their primary responsibilities include setting up data sources, optimizing queries for performance and cost, and integrating Athena with other AWS services for business intelligence solutions.

What is the difference between Athena vs Data Analyst?

AspectAthenaData Analyst
Required CredentialsNone mandatory; familiarity with SQL and cloud services helpfulBachelor's degree in data science, statistics, or related field; often certifications
Work EnvironmentCloud-based, serverless querying service within AWSOffice or remote, analyzing data sets, creating reports
Industry UsageUsed by data engineers, analysts, and cloud professionals for querying dataUsed across industries for interpreting data and supporting decision-making

In summary, Athena is a cloud-based querying service primarily used for data retrieval within AWS, while a Data Analyst focuses on interpreting data, creating reports, and providing insights across various industries. Both roles involve working with data, but Athena is a tool, whereas a Data Analyst is a profession.

Essential Job Responsibilities:
  • Assesses presenting illness, risk factors, family history, psychosocial situation, and cultural factors; and performs an appropriate physical examination.
  • Assesses patient status by obtaining health history through patient/family interviews and chart reviews
  • Orders/perform appropriate laboratory diagnostic and other screening tests. Seeks other information as needed, including consultation with physicians and other clinicians, for evaluation of illness. Integrates data to determine a diagnosis and therapeutic plan, including identification of any health risks.
  • Develops and implements treatment plans by prescribing/dispensing medications and/or injections in compliance with medical practice guidelines and state laws.
  • Instruct patient/family regarding medications and treatments.
  • Educates patient/family on health promotion/illness prevention.
  • Recommends appropriate community resources to meet patient/family needs.
  • Communicates appropriate case management information to other professionals and community agencies.
  • Prepares documentation for medical records including updating patient medical charts by posting examination and test results, diagnosis, medications, and treatment in a written/computerized manner.
  • Participates in chart reviews, staff education, clinical guideline development, and other continuing education and quality assurance activities to demonstrate compliance with standards, regulations, policies, and procedures.
  • Complies with patient confidentiality requirements.
  • Promotes patient advocacy.
  • Provides monitoring and continuity of care between visits according to treatment plan including triaging patient calls/emails.
